A note on the derived semifield planes of order 16

Authors: Johnson, N.L.;

A note on the derived semifield planes of order 16

Abstract

An affine plane ~" is tangentially transitive with respect to a subplane ~re if ~r admits a collineation group which fixes ~'e pointwise and acts transitive on each of the tangent pencils to ~r o. Jha [6] has studied finite translation planes ~" which are tangentially transitive with respect to ~re and has shown that if the order of ~is not 16 then ]rr[ = Irrel 2 and 7r is a generalized Hall plane. If ]~r I = 16, 1r is a generalized Hall plane but the case that I~'~1 = 2 is possible. In [9], Johnson and Ostrom have shown that there is a unique tangentially transitive plane of order 16 and with respect to a subplane of order 2, Walker [14] has also independently obtained this same result. General ized Hall planes are precisely those planes of order q2 that may be derived from semifield planes whose coordinate semifields have middle nuclei which contain GF(q). Kleinfeld [10] has shown that there is exactly one semifield plane of order 16 with middle nucleus GF(4); the semifield plane with kern GF(4). In this article we determine the nonisomorphic planes which may be derived from the semifield plane of order 16 and kern GF(4). We show that there are exactly three such planes ~-,,, -n" E, 7rH: • "n is a generalized Hall plane which admits affine homologies and whose full collineation group has point orbits on the line at infinity of lengths 12, 3, 1, 1 or 12, 3, 2. ~r E is not a generalized Hall plane and admits affine elations with three centers whose full collineation group is isomorphic to $3 × P G L ( 3 , 2) and has infinite point orbits of lengths 3, 14. rr,, is a generalized Hall plane which admits an isomorphic collineation group as that of 7r E and whose action on £~ coincides with that of rrz.
